Porch where dining and dancing took place. Winks Lodge in Lincoln Hills (Gilpin County). Built in 1925 by architect Wendall Hamlet, the lodge was a place for African Americans to escape the city for rest and relaxation in the mountains.

Index to the World War II dead and missing from the State of Colorado prepared by the War Department in 1946. Index includes: statistics of each Colorado county and an alphabetical listing of the dead and missing by county,

Works Progress Administration (WPA) workers in overalls or jeans, gloves, and hats hold shovels and walk in the flood damaged creek bed in Coal Creek Canyon (Jefferson County), Colorado. Shows flood debris, sand and the eroded edges of Coal Creek.

This is a program for a concert given at Central on January 1, 1898 by the Yale Glee and Banjo Clubs. It has a list of patronesses, the order for the concert, a list of members from each club, and other concert dates for their Christmas Tour.

View of Yellowstone Lake, looking south where the Yellowstone River leaves the lake, Yellowstone National Park, Wyoming. Shows a narrow sandbar with footprints, marsh, tall pines. Stevenson Island and the Absaroka Range are in the distance.
